            CA OSLER P417-3-3-105-027 · Item · February 19, 1907
            Part of Harvey Cushing Fonds

            Letter to Daniel Coit Gilman from William Osler, 13, Norham Gardens, Oxford, Oxfordshire, England. Thanks for returning the manuscript and for his criticism. Interrogation on the name to chose. He will bring out more clearly the distinction between the requirements of a cataloguer or attendant and the men who are doing administration work. They want to present the project (a training ground in Oxford for the librarians of Great Britain) to Mr. Carnegie and the best person to present it attractively to him could be John Morley. Civilities.

            CA OSLER P417-3-3-103-63 · Item · November 5, 1905
            Part of Harvey Cushing Fonds

            Letter to Daniel Coit Gilman from William Osler, 7, Norham Gardens, Oxford, Oxfordshire, England. News about settling in Oxford. Description of his official rooms, and of his class, of the out patient department. Description of his daily work. He enjoys being a member of Christ Church. Picture to himself that Burton or Locke may have inhabited his quarters. He enjoys sitting at the Hebdomadal Council of the University. He is Curator of the Bodleian. News from his family. Mention of his trip to America in December. Greets to Remsen, Gildersleeve and Ames. Mention that he wrote to Welch.

            CA OSLER P417-3-3-118-014 · Item · August 10, 1914
            Part of Harvey Cushing Fonds

            Letter to D'Arcy Power from William Osler, 13, Norham Gardens, Oxford, Oxfordshire, England. Hopes his boy has got back safely. Mentions that his wife and Revere sailed to Quebec ten days ago. He was supposed to follow September 5, but cancelled. Compliments and thanks for his lecture. Tells him that the schools have been transformed with 350 beds in.
